Fixating entirely on Body Mass Index (BMI)—a flawed metrics system originally designed for populations, not individuals—often leads to weight stigma. This stigma causes stress and can lead healthcare providers to overlook underlying medical issues, misattributing symptoms solely to a patient’s weight. Holistic Biomarkers

The story of body positivity and wellness is a journey from radical activism to a mainstream lifestyle that prioritizes mental well-being alongside physical health. Originally rooted in 1960s fat rights activism, it has evolved into a global wellness trend focused on self-love, functional health, and dismantling unrealistic beauty standards.
